Grade of knowledge of minocycline-based prolonged-release devices used in periodontal therapy by professor at the dental care unit, UNIANDES. Universidad y Sociedad [online]. 2020, vol.12, n.5, pp. 183-189.  Epub Oct 02, 2020. ISSN 2218-3620.

One of the most recommended antibiotics in periodontal therapy is minocycline, which has pharmacological problems that limit its use; therefore, the development of controlled release systems has allowed its use. The objective of this investigation is to determine the grade of knowledge that professor at the Dental Care Unit, UNIANDES have about this therapy, for which the 28 teacher-tutors were surveyed, obtaining as results that most of the teachers surveyed present little or any knowledge about this antibiotic, its pharmaceutical forms and its use in periodontal therapy.
